What is an overnight merchandiser?

Overnight Merchandisers are retail employees who work during nighttime hours to stock shelves, organize products, and set up displays in stores while customers are not present. Their work ensures that the store is fully stocked, clean, and visually appealing each morning. Overnight Merchandisers may also be responsible for inventory management, checking product expiration dates, and assisting with store resets or seasonal changes. This role typically requires physical stamina,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ently or as part of a small team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an overnight merchandiser?

To thrive as an Overnight Merchandiser, you need physical stamina, attention to detail, time management skills,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with inventory management systems, handheld scanners, and planogram software is typically required. Strong teamwork, adaptability, and communication skills help individuals excel in fast-paced, changing retail environments. These abilities ensure accurate product placement, efficient restocking, and a well-organized store ready for customers each morning.

What are some common challenges faced by overnight merchandisers, and how can they be addressed?

Overnight Merchandisers often face challenges such as tight deadlines for resetting displays, working independently with minimal supervision, and managing physical fatigue from standing or lifting for extended periods. To address these, it's helpful to develop strong time-management skills, maintain good communication with team members during shift changes, and use proper lifting techniques to prevent injury. Staying organized and maintaining a positive attitude can also make overnight shifts more manageable and productive.

What is the difference between Overnight Merchandiser vs Stock Associate?

AspectOvernight MerchandiserStock Associate
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ent, sometimes retail or merchandising cert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ent, retail experience helpful
Work EnvironmentStores during off-hours, often in backroom or sales floor areasStore floor, stockrooms, customer-facing areas
Employer & Industry UsageRetail stores, supermarkets, big-box retailersRetail stores, supermarkets, warehouses

Overnight Merchandisers focus on stocking shelves, arranging displays, and inventory management during non-business hours, often working behind the scenes. Stock Associates typically handle stocking, organizing, and assisting customers during store hours. While both roles involve stocking, the key difference lies in the timing and scope of work, with Overnight Merchandisers working overnight shifts primarily on merchandising tasks.
